Romanian PSL-54C - $579.95 (AIM Surplus) New Romanian Cugir manufactured model PSL-54C semi-automatic 7.62x54R rifles. Inlcudes LPS TIP2 scope and mount, 2-10rd magazines, magazine pouch, field cleaning kit, and optic case.
